1. AI-Powered Candidate Sourcing & Discovery

Traditional candidate sourcing is often a time-consuming and labor-intensive process, relying heavily on manual database searches, professional networking sites, and job board postings. Recruiters spend hours sifting through profiles, often missing highly qualified passive candidates who aren’t actively looking but would be a perfect fit. AI fundamentally transforms this by acting as an intelligent super-sleuth. A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data from diverse sources—including social media, public databases, industry forums, and even academic papers—to identify candidates whose skills, experience, and even cultural fit align perfectly with specific job requirements. This goes far beyond keyword matching; AI can infer capabilities, predict potential, and even identify individuals with niche skills that might not be explicitly listed on a resume. For instance, an AI tool could identify a developer who actively contributes to specific open-source projects, indicating a skill level and passion that traditional searches might miss. 2. Automated Resume Screening & Ranking

The sheer volume of applications for any given role can overwhelm even the most efficient recruiting teams. Manually reviewing hundreds, if not thousands, of resumes is not only monotonous but also prone to human bias and oversight. AI-powered resume screening tools offer a powerful solution. These systems can rapidly parse resumes, extracting key information such as skills, experience, education, and achievements with incredible accuracy. Beyond simple keyword matching, advanced AI can understand context, identify transferable skills, and even assess the relevance of experience from non-traditional backgrounds. More importantly, AI can rank candidates based on predetermined criteria, providing a prioritized list that significantly streamlines the initial review process. This doesn’t just save time; it ensures a more objective evaluation of candidates, reducing unconscious bias often present in manual screening. For example, an AI could be trained to identify candidates with strong problem-solving skills demonstrated through project work, even if they don’t have direct industry experience. This allows recruiters to focus their valuable time on interviewing the most promising candidates, rather than spending hours on administrative sifting. 3. Enhanced Candidate Experience with AI Chatbots

A positive candidate experience is crucial for attracting and retaining top talent, yet many companies struggle to provide timely and personalized communication to all applicants. AI chatbots are transforming this challenge into an opportunity for engagement and efficiency. These intelligent bots can be deployed on career pages, job application forms, or even within messaging platforms to provide instant answers to common candidate questions—from job descriptions and company culture to application status and interview process details. This immediate responsiveness not only enhances the candidate’s perception of the company but also frees up recruiters from answering repetitive inquiries. Furthermore, chatbots can guide candidates through the application process, pre-screen them with relevant questions, and even provide personalized feedback or suggestions for other suitable roles. Imagine a candidate applying at 2 AM and getting instant, accurate information about their application status or specific role requirements. This 24/7 availability significantly improves engagement and reduces candidate drop-off rates due to lack of communication. 4. Predictive Analytics for Retention & Turnover

Employee turnover is a costly problem for businesses, impacting productivity, morale, and recruitment expenses. Proactively identifying employees at risk of leaving allows organizations to intervene and implement retention strategies before it’s too late. AI-powered predictive analytics tools analyze a multitude of internal and external data points to forecast potential turnover. This data can include performance reviews, compensation changes, tenure, manager feedback, engagement survey results, promotion history, and even external economic indicators. By identifying patterns and correlations that might be imperceptible to human analysis, AI can flag employees or departments with a higher likelihood of attrition. For instance, an AI might detect that employees who haven’t received a promotion in three years, combined with a dip in their recent engagement scores, are a high flight risk. This insight enables HR leaders to develop targeted retention programs, such as mentorship opportunities, career development plans, or adjusted compensation strategies, for at-risk individuals or groups. 5. Intelligent Interview Scheduling & Coordination

The logistical nightmare of coordinating interviews across multiple candidates, hiring managers, and panel members is a universal pain point in recruiting. The endless back-and-forth emails, calendar conflicts, and rescheduled meetings consume an inordinate amount of time and create frustrating delays. AI-powered intelligent scheduling tools eliminate this administrative burden entirely. These systems integrate directly with calendars, automatically finding optimal time slots based on everyone’s availability, time zones, and even preferred meeting durations. They can send out invitations, manage confirmations, and automatically send reminders, drastically reducing no-shows and rescheduling efforts. More advanced systems can even factor in interviewer expertise or preferences, ensuring the right interview panel is assigned to each candidate. Imagine a system that automatically proposes three time slots, allows the candidate to pick one, and then updates all relevant calendars, sends out meeting links, and confirms with all participants—all without a single human touch. This not only saves immense administrative time but also speeds up the entire interview process, creating a more professional and efficient experience for candidates and internal teams alike. 6. Personalized Employee Onboarding Journeys

A robust onboarding process is critical for new hire success, engagement, and retention. However, generic, one-size-fits-all onboarding can leave new employees feeling overwhelmed or disengaged. AI allows for the creation of highly personalized onboarding journeys tailored to individual roles, departments, and even learning styles. AI can analyze a new hire’s background, their role’s specific requirements, and their previous experiences to recommend relevant training modules, assign appropriate mentors, and provide access to necessary resources at the optimal time. For instance, a sales hire might immediately receive access to product training and CRM tutorials, while a software engineer might be directed to specific code repositories and development environment setup guides. AI can also power intelligent chatbots to answer common onboarding questions, guiding new employees through policies, benefits, and company culture in an interactive and accessible way. 7. Automated Performance Review Insights

Performance reviews are often dreaded by both managers and employees, primarily due to their subjective nature, the time investment required, and the difficulty in providing objective, actionable feedback. AI is transforming performance management by bringing data-driven insights and efficiency to the process. AI tools can analyze various data points—project contributions, feedback from colleagues (360-degree reviews), communication patterns, goal attainment, and even sentiment from written reviews—to identify trends, highlight strengths, and pinpoint areas for development. This allows managers to prepare for reviews with a comprehensive, objective overview of an employee’s performance, significantly reducing bias. For example, an AI could summarize an employee’s contributions across multiple projects over the last quarter, identifying consistent high performance in specific areas or recurring challenges. It can also help managers articulate feedback more effectively by suggesting specific examples or recommending development resources. While the human conversation remains paramount, AI provides the backbone of objective data and insights, making performance reviews more strategic, less stressful, and ultimately more effective in fostering growth and development. This data-driven approach elevates performance management from a compliance exercise to a powerful tool for talent development.

8. AI-Driven Skill Gap Analysis & Training Recommendations

In a rapidly evolving business environment, ensuring your workforce possesses the skills necessary for future success is paramount. Identifying current and future skill gaps, however, is a complex challenge. AI provides an unparalleled advantage in this area. AI-driven platforms can analyze an organization’s existing talent pool, mapping current employee skills against future business objectives, industry trends, and emerging technologies. By processing performance data, project assignments, training records, and even external market data, AI can precisely pinpoint where skill deficiencies exist within teams or across the entire organization. Beyond identification, these systems can then recommend highly personalized training and development paths for individual employees or entire departments. For example, if a company is shifting towards greater AI adoption, the system might identify a gap in data science skills among a specific team and recommend targeted online courses or internal workshops. 9. Smart Compliance Monitoring & Reporting

Navigating the complex and ever-changing landscape of HR compliance is a significant burden for organizations, with potential legal and financial repercussions for missteps. AI is emerging as a powerful ally in ensuring continuous compliance and streamlining reporting. AI-powered systems can monitor changes in labor laws, regulations, and industry standards across various jurisdictions, alerting HR teams to necessary policy updates or procedural adjustments. Beyond monitoring, these tools can automatically audit internal processes, employee records, and policy adherence to identify potential compliance risks before they escalate. For example, an AI could flag inconsistencies in hiring documentation, ensure all required training certifications are up-to-date, or verify that pay equity standards are being met across different employee groups. Furthermore, AI can automate the generation of compliance reports, aggregating data from disparate HR systems to produce accurate, timely documentation required for audits or regulatory submissions. This not only reduces the administrative overhead associated with compliance but also significantly mitigates risk, allowing HR teams to operate with greater confidence and focus on strategic initiatives rather than reactive fire-fighting. 10. AI for DEI (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ion) Initiatives

Building a truly diverse, equitable, and inclusive workplace is a moral imperative and a proven driver of business success. AI can be a powerful tool in advancing DEI initiatives, helping organizations identify and mitigate biases, and create more inclusive environments. AI-powered tools can analyze job descriptions for biased language, ensuring they attract a broader and more diverse pool of candidates. During the screening process, AI can anonymize candidate details or focus purely on skills and qualifications, helping to reduce unconscious bias. Furthermore, AI can analyze hiring patterns, promotion rates, and compensation data to uncover systemic inequities that might otherwise go unnoticed. For example, an AI might detect that a particular demographic group consistently experiences longer time-to-promotion despite similar performance metrics. Beyond recruitment, AI can analyze employee feedback and communication patterns to identify areas where inclusivity might be lacking or where specific groups feel less heard. The insights derived from these analyses enable HR and leadership to implement targeted DEI strategies, measure their effectiveness, and foster a truly equitable culture. When implemented thoughtfully and ethically, AI can serve as a catalyst for creating workplaces where every individual has an equal opportunity to thrive and contribute.
